Project Abstract

**Abstract
** Climate change is a pressing global issue that has significant implications for wildlife populations and ecosystems worldwide. This research project aims to investigate the impact of climate change on wildlife population dynamics, focusing on how changing climatic conditions are affecting the abundance, distribution, and behavior of various species. Through a comprehensive literature review and empirical research, this study explores the mechanisms through which climate change influences wildlife populations and the potential ecological consequences of these changes. The research begins with an introduction that outlines the background of the study, presents the problem statement, objectives, limitations, scope, significance, structure of the research, and definitions of key terms. Subsequently, a thorough review of existing literature is conducted to synthesize current knowledge on the effects of climate change on wildlife populations. The literature review covers topics such as the direct and indirect impacts of climate change on species, shifts in species distributions, changes in phenology and behavior, and the role of habitat loss and fragmentation. The methodology section details the research design, data collection methods, and analytical approaches used to investigate the impact of climate change on wildlife population dynamics. This chapter includes discussions on sampling techniques, data analysis procedures, and the selection of study sites and species. Through a combination of field surveys, remote sensing, and statistical modeling, this study aims to quantify the effects of climate change on wildlife populations and identify potential adaptation strategies for species at risk. The results and discussion chapter presents the findings of the research, highlighting key trends, patterns, and relationships observed in the data. This section examines the specific impacts of climate change on selected wildlife species, assesses the implications for population dynamics and ecosystem functioning, and discusses the potential conservation implications of these changes. By exploring the complex interactions between climate change and wildlife populations, this research contributes valuable insights to the field of conservation biology and informs management strategies for protecting biodiversity in a changing climate. In conclusion, this research project provides a comprehensive analysis of the impact of climate change on wildlife population dynamics, highlighting the various ways in which changing environmental conditions are shaping the future of ecosystems and species survival. By elucidating the mechanisms through which climate change affects wildlife populations, this study offers important implications for conservation efforts and underscores the urgent need for proactive measures to mitigate the impacts of climate change on biodiversity.

Project Overview

The research project on "The Impact of Climate Change on Wildlife Population Dynamics" aims to investigate the effects of climate change on various wildlife populations and their dynamics. Climate change is a pressing global issue that has been shown to have profound impacts on ecosystems and biodiversity worldwide. Wildlife populations are particularly vulnerable to these changes, as they rely on specific environmental conditions for survival and reproduction. The project will focus on understanding how climate change influences wildlife populations in terms of their distribution, abundance, reproductive success, and overall population dynamics. This will involve studying different species across various habitats and regions to capture the diversity of responses to changing environmental conditions. By examining these dynamics, the research will provide valuable insights into the mechanisms through which climate change affects wildlife populations and the potential consequences for biodiversity conservation. Key objectives of the study include identifying the specific climatic factors that have the greatest impact on wildlife populations, assessing the resilience of different species to climate change, and exploring potential strategies for mitigating the negative effects on wildlife. By addressing these objectives, the research aims to contribute to the scientific understanding of the complex interactions between climate change and wildlife populations. The project will employ a multidisciplinary approach, combining field observations, ecological modeling, and data analysis to investigate the dynamics of wildlife populations in the context of climate change. By integrating these different methodologies, the research will provide a comprehensive assessment of the current and future challenges faced by wildlife in a changing climate. Overall, the project on "The Impact of Climate Change on Wildlife Population Dynamics" seeks to advance our knowledge of how climate change is shaping the dynamics of wildlife populations and to inform conservation efforts aimed at protecting biodiversity in the face of ongoing environmental changes. Through this research, we hope to contribute to the development of effective strategies for mitigating the impacts of climate change on wildlife and promoting the long-term sustainability of ecosystems and biodiversity.
